POWERING STUDY TECHNIQUE APPLIED TO A PUSHER TUG GEARED-DIESEL INSTALLATION

This paper presents a rational approach to the selection of the main components of a medium-speed marine diesel installation. The technique described matches the engine, reduction gear, and propeller and determines a measure of merit for each combination. This matching calculation is based on the speed-power characteristics of the vessel's hull, essential information about the trade route, and vendors' prices. A computer program developed using this design technique is presented with the results of a pusher tugboat powering study.
